Explain the differences and/or similarities between solarization and the Sabattier effect

Respuesta :

ccook4159 ccook4159
  • 02-12-2021

Solarization is similar to Sabattier effect, except it is specific to situation where the film is massively overexposed. The same process and technique is used for both. Both Solarization and Sabattier Effects are techniques used in photography. The difference is the amount of exposure that the photos undergo.Answer:
